The Getting old Mind: What is actually Ordinary and What is actually Not
Some cognitive changes are indeed A part of typical ageing. As we grow older, our brains procedure info much more little by little, and we might need much more time to learn new things or remember data. You could possibly at times overlook in which you parked your vehicle or maybe the title of the acquaintance you haven't found in several years. Regular aging could indicate taking extended to recall data, occasional difficulty acquiring words, from time to time misplacing products, or slight trouble with multitasking.
Even so, ordinary ageing mustn't noticeably interfere together with your each day operating. You should nonetheless have the capacity to manage your finances, adhere to your medication timetable, retain your residence, and interact in your favorite routines.
Gentle Cognitive Impairment: The In-In between State
Martha noticed she was having hassle next her e book club discussions. Her medical doctor diagnosed her with Mild Cognitive Impairment—a condition that exists during the Place among regular getting old and dementia.
MCI will cause cognitive alterations which can be noticeable for you and infrequently to those near to you, but they do not substantially disrupt your day to day pursuits. Think of MCI like a yellow warning light-weight—not but pink, but certainly not inexperienced.
With MCI, you might overlook vital discussions or appointments, shed your prepare of considered throughout conversations, have improved issues earning conclusions, feel confused by intricate jobs, or battle to seek out your way in unfamiliar environments.
Irrespective of these worries, you can usually still handle everyday responsibilities independently. You remember to consider medications, can get ready meals, and manage domestic finances, even when these responsibilities acquire a lot more focus than ahead of.
Alzheimer's Condition: When Cognitive Changes Disrupt Independence
Compared with MCI, Alzheimer's ailment progressively impacts your capability to function independently. It really is the commonest type of dementia, accounting for some circumstances.
Frank's family became involved when he bought misplaced driving to your supermarket he'd visited weekly for twenty a long time. He also started owning difficulty controlling his examining account and would talk to exactly the same inquiries regularly, not remembering he experienced now received responses.
In early Alzheimer's, you may expertise important memory read more reduction that disrupts way of life, issues in arranging or fixing difficulties, and issues completing common jobs. Men and women usually knowledge confusion about time or spot, difficulty comprehending Visible photographs, and new problems with words and phrases in speaking or crafting. Misplacing points without having being able to retrace techniques, diminished judgment, withdrawal from pursuits, and changes in temper and individuality can also be popular indications.
As Alzheimer's progresses, symptoms develop into much more critical. Ultimately, persons need support with essential actions like dressing, taking in, and private treatment.
Critical Differences and Brain Modifications
The principal distinction amongst MCI and Alzheimer's lies in useful independence. With MCI, day by day performing stays mostly intact Even with visible cognitive improvements. With Alzheimer's, cognitive decrease interferes drastically with the opportunity to deal with independently.
One more critical variation is progression. Though all people today with Alzheimer's working experience worsening indicators after a while, MCI follows a significantly less predictable route. Some individuals with MCI remain steady For many years, some improve and return to usual cognition, and Other individuals development to Alzheimer's or Yet another method of dementia. Investigation implies around ten-fifteen% of people with MCI produce dementia every year.
Both equally circumstances require Actual physical modifications from the Mind, but to unique degrees. In MCI, brain scans may possibly clearly show mild shrinkage during the hippocampus and small accumulations of irregular proteins. In Alzheimer's, these alterations are more intensive, with popular plaques and tangles disrupting interaction between Mind cells and eventually creating mobile Dying.
Running Memory Fears
Though there isn't any FDA-approved remedies especially for MCI, investigation suggests several strategies which will enable. Joseph was diagnosed with MCI soon after noticing memory problems. His health practitioner advisable a comprehensive tactic: Joseph joined a walking club, adopted a Mediterranean-design and style eating plan, started out playing bridge on a regular basis, and tackled his significant blood pressure. After six months, he found his pondering appeared clearer.
Current management tactics for MCI consist of standard Actual physical physical exercise, Mediterranean or Brain food plan, cognitive stimulation, social engagement, correct management of clinical disorders, high quality rest, and pressure management.
For Alzheimer's ailment, cure ordinarily includes medications that may temporarily improve signs and symptoms or slow development, management of behavioral signs, supportive care given that the sickness innovations, and Life style interventions much like These suggested for MCI.
Several prescription drugs are at the moment accepted for Alzheimer's, such as cholinesterase inhibitors and memantine. While these Never prevent the underlying Mind alterations, they're able to support sustain functionality extended.
The Power of Neuropsychological Assessment
When you are concerned about alterations in your memory or contemplating qualities, a neuropsychological assessment gives probably the most thorough analysis.
Compared with brief screenings at a doctor's Business office, a neuropsychological evaluation carefully examines unique cognitive domains by way of specialised exams. This in-depth approach can differentiate among usual getting older, MCI, and Alzheimer's, even from the early stages when distinctions are subtle.
Through the evaluation, a neuropsychologist will evaluate your memory, interest, language skills, Visible-spatial competencies, scheduling, Business, difficulty-solving, processing speed, and reasoning qualities. The final results provide a baseline for checking improvements after a while and information suggestions for cure and aid.
